The Private 5G Market is gaining strong momentum as enterprises across manufacturing, logistics, mining, healthcare, transportation, energy, and other industries seek faster, more reliable, and secure wireless connectivity. Unlike public 5G networks, private 5G networks are dedicated to a specific organization or location, enabling enterprises to control network performance, security, devices, and data.

Private 5G combines high-speed connectivity, low latency, massive device capacity, and enhanced reliability. These capabilities make it suitable for industrial applications such as autonomous mobile robots (AMRs), automated guided vehicles (AGVs), machine vision, predictive maintenance, remote monitoring, and real-time production control.

Key Factors Driving the Private 5G Market

The increasing adoption of Industry 4.0 is one of the major factors driving private 5G deployment. Manufacturers are connecting machines, sensors, robots, cameras, and industrial control systems to create intelligent and highly automated production environments. Private 5G provides the wireless performance required for these connected operations while reducing dependence on physical cabling.

The growing demand for low-latency communication is another important growth factor. Applications such as industrial automation, remote equipment control, autonomous vehicles, and real-time video analytics require rapid data transmission and reliable connectivity. Private 5G can support these requirements more effectively than many traditional wireless technologies.

Network security and data control are also encouraging enterprises to adopt private 5G. Organizations can deploy dedicated networks within factories, warehouses, ports, campuses, and other controlled environments. This allows sensitive operational data to remain within enterprise-controlled infrastructure while providing centralized management of connected devices.

Private 5G Applications

Manufacturing represents a major application area for private 5G. Manufacturers can use the technology to connect robots, sensors, cameras, and automated systems. High-bandwidth connectivity also supports machine vision and real-time monitoring.

In logistics and warehousing, private 5G enables communication between autonomous robots, warehouse management systems, sensors, and workers. Ports and airports can similarly use private networks to support connected vehicles, asset tracking, surveillance, and automated operations.

The mining and energy sectors can use private 5G for remote equipment monitoring, autonomous machinery, worker safety, and communications across large industrial sites. In healthcare, private 5G can support connected medical devices, high-resolution imaging, and reliable communication across hospitals and campuses.

Technology Trends

The integration of edge computing and private 5G is creating additional opportunities. Processing data closer to connected devices can reduce latency and improve response times for mission-critical applications. Artificial intelligence (AI), Internet of Things (IoT), robotics, and digital twins can further increase the value of private 5G networks.

Network slicing, cloud-native 5G architectures, Open RAN, and advanced spectrum-sharing models are also contributing to the evolution of private wireless networks.

Future Outlook

The Private 5G Market is expected to expand as enterprises accelerate digital transformation and industrial automation. Falling infrastructure costs, broader spectrum availability, growing ecosystem support, and increasing demand for secure industrial connectivity are expected to encourage deployments.

Going forward, private 5G is likely to become an important connectivity layer for smart factories, autonomous systems, connected logistics, and mission-critical industrial applications. Its combination of speed, reliability, security, and low latency positions it as a key technology for next-generation enterprise connectivity.
